Would like to ask for assistance with a 0-25mV pressure sensor that is made of a piezo bridge.   The excitation voltage is 10V. How could I increase the 0-25mV to 0-5V or 0-10V without introducing a lot of error when the inherent accuracy is+/- 2%?  If I use an Op Amp it think it would have too much noise.  I do not have a precision power supply. Use oversampling? Use reference voltage?

 

Actually, the reading I am looking to amplify and read is only between the 8-20mV range.
